Can I substitute channels in my basic package?
We strive offer you satellite programming that is as affordable as possible. One way to help keep costs lower is to provide stations in packages, rather than mostly a la carte. Allowing customers to substitute channels would have the adverse effect of forcing prices to be raised, both for overall programming, and for a la carte stations. To prevent this, no substitutions are allowed.

Our Homeowners Assoc. does not allow satellite dishes.
THEY DON'T HAVE THE RIGHT! The dish antenna sizes are 18" or 20" and comply with the Satellite Consumer Bill of Rights, a regulation released by the FCC on August 6, 1996. This regulation PREEMPTS area zoning ordinances and Homeowner Association covenants and restrictions on DBS dish antennas. This rule was required by Congress in the 1996 Telecommunications Act. Some HOA'S have been fighting to keep restriction rights by threatening court action on tenants with dish antennas, in some cases arguing that a dish antenna is installed in a common area, calling the air space above the homeowners roof where the dish antenna is installed, the common area.
